New study out: mercury level in children with autism is no higher than in other children. This refutes the theory that children with autism require costly and painful therapies (chellation) to remove mercury from the blood.

www.examiner.com Yesterday, the Los Angeles Times reported that findings from a recent study show mercury levels in the blood of children with autism are no higher than of children who are not autistic. The study, originally ...

Autism and Siblings - We have 3 boys, only one of which has autism. Our yougest son is getting to the age where we have to sit him down and explain what's going on with his brother, because he's beginning to realize something is different. The emotions of siblings can be very complicated. Is your other child/ren alternatively protective and angry? Jealous of the attention? Embarrassed? What are you thoughts?

I've posted links or contact numbers for all the elementary school districts in the greater Phoenix area. You can find them in the School district Special Education Department box along the right side of any of my articles on Examiner (you may have to scroll down a bit).

I knew nothing about having our son evaluated by the school district when he was 2 until another parent told me during a birthday party. Hopefully, this information will be helpful to someone.

www.examiner.com One thing many parents of very young children do not know is that if you suspect your child may have autism, your local school district may be a great resource for support and services, even if your child ...
